Navigating the Trademark Registration Process

Embarking on the journey of trademark registration can feel daunting , but a well-defined comprehension of the phases is crucial. Initially, a thorough search of existing trademarks is needed to assess potential conflicts . Following this, you’ll submit an application with the relevant brand office , including a accurate portrayal of your symbol . Be prepared for a thorough examination and potential challenges, requiring a persuasive reply . Finally, upon allowance, your trademark will be registered , granting you unique rights to its use within a defined field.

Safeguarding The Name : Common Trademark Registration Mistakes to Steer Clear Of

Many companies make significant slip-ups when submitting for trademark registration. Failing to perform a complete investigation of existing brands is a major pitfall, potentially resulting in denial or, worse, expensive judicial conflicts. Also, selecting a descriptive phrase that simply portrays your items is often ineligible . Finally, incorrectly classifying the proper wares and offerings – the Nice System is key – can weaken your submission and future ownership . Attentive consideration is essential .
